Masseria Le Cerase: destination wedding venue in Conversano, Italy

Masseria Le Cerase

Conversano, Puglia · Hotel

Masseria Le Cerase operates as a working farmstead hotel where you bring in your own catering team to cook from the venue's professional kitchen, a practical setup that gives you control over your menu while keeping costs predictable. The property accommodates up to 150 guests across 100 square meters of covered indoor space, with an additional outdoor capacity for ceremonies and receptions. Located 30–40 minutes from two major airports, it functions as a self-contained wedding base where guests can stay on-site for the mandatory 3-night minimum.

Masseria Pavone, wedding venue in Martina Franca, Italy

Masseria Pavone

Martina Franca, Puglia · Estate

Masseria Pavone is an estate near Martina Franca in Puglia, with an on-site chapel, outdoor ceremony space and the option to hold a legally binding ceremony on the property. Catholic ceremonies are among the religious options available, and a meeting and banquet space handles the reception. Accommodation runs across eight apartment and room types, from a One-Bedroom Apartment for two guests up to a Deluxe Triple Room sleeping six, with several Two-Bedroom and Garden View Apartments in between. We estimate a countryside setting with a pool, in a restored, elegant style, roughly 75 minutes from Bari (BRI).
